There is a writeup on the new feature at the Analytics Blog here: www.epikone.com/blog/2007/12/13/surprise-new-google-analytics-features/. This is a great source for GA information, I check it out often. He talks about the new feature, which is a multi-line graphing feature, as well as the new ga.js upgrade code which is now available. He also points to the official "Migration Guide" just put out by Google within the post which is very, very handy.

The compare two metrics is nice but pretty limited.
It would actually be pretty useful if it did more then put them on a graph but actually worked out some extra 'one step further info': - correlation - abnormalities of segemnts (EG keyword.A- their is no correleation between bounce rate & conversion rate while all other keywords there is) Now, I want to see a real upgrade- Custom segemnts. & while they're at it - custom metrics. And if we're going down that road, tear down the wall between, normal metrics, conversion metrics & Ecommerce metrics. They are all part of the same.
